6 months Need only immediate joiners Role Description This is a key role within the Data space at Admiral. The QA Engineer will work in multi-disciplined squads focusing on optimizing the DevSecOps model of delivery. The strategic vision includes enhancing Admiral’s cloud presence and shifting left in the testing process, with a particular focus on in-sprint test automation. Key Responsibilities Work in a multi-discipline integrated team, refining and prioritizing backlogs while delivering in an Agile methodology. Define tools and frameworks to develop and maintain test automation. Collaborate with the development team to establish strategy and best practices. Provide clear and accurate documentation for tests and test automation. Integrate automated tests into the CI/CD pipeline. Continuously update skills by staying informed of advancements in testing and test automation. Key Skills/Knowledge/Experience Extensive experience in testing and test automation. Expertise in building and enhancing complex test automation frameworks using

Playwright with TypeScript. Strong experience in BDD frameworks like Cucumber or similar. Proficiency with Google Cloud Platform

(GCP)

components. Experience in integrating automated testing into CI/CD pipelines using

Azure DevOps. Hands-on experience with

YAML / PowerShell

scripting. Knowledge of working in Agile environments and participating in QA-related Agile ceremonies. Familiarity with tools like Confluence, JIRA, and Git. Person Specification Strong communication abilities. Team collaboration and supportive mindset. Seniority level
